Ryan Lochte’s estranged wife, Kayla Rae Reid, appeared to accuse the Olympic swimmer of ‘betrayal’ as she opened up on how their marriage and divorce left her ‘broken’.
Reid announced earlier this month that she had filed for divorce from the six-time gold medalist in March, after seven years of marriage.
At the time, the former Playboy playmate branded the divorce ‘painful’ and referenced ‘trials we didn’t choose or see coming’, while Lochte said he was ‘deeply grateful for the life we’ve built together’.
But neither revealed exactly what led to their marriage becoming ‘irretrievably broken’.
As revealed by the Daily Mail, however, the couple owe nearly $270,000 in various debts, while they are also fighting over the custody of their three children – Caiden Zane, seven, Liv Rae, five, and Georgia June, one.

Now, Reid has taken to social media to post more cryptic comments about the divorce, including that she is ‘stepping into the best chapter of her life’.
The former Playboy playmate posted a series of pictures and videos alongside ‘reminders’ of what she is ‘telling herself right now’.
‘Sometimes God allows the betrayal… because it leads to the breakthrough,’ one read.
‘Divorce isn’t the end of my story. It’s the beginning of my rebirth… I didn’t choose to be broken, but I’m choosing to rebuild.’
She added: ‘You’re stepping into the best chapter of your life – you just have to heal first… most people have no idea what I’ve endured.
‘Ignore their opinions. Truth always reveals itself.’
Kayla’s petition for divorce, filed in north central Florida’s Alachua County, asked the court for ‘sole parenting responsibility’ or at least ‘ultimate decision-making authority’ and ‘majority timesharing,’ Daily Mail previously reported.
‘Wife is fit and proper to assume sole parental responsibility for the minor children of the parties. Shared parental responsibility would be detrimental to the children,’ her lawyers wrote.

However, Lochte responded by insisting it was in the best interests of Caiden, Liv and Georgia for their parents to share custody.
But his April 28 counter-petition, prepared by attorney Justin Jacobson, also included multiple errors when it came to details of their birthdays and places of birth.
Lochte said all three were born in May but – as Kayla pointed out in a subsequent filing – Caiden was born June 8, 2017, Liv was born June 17, 2019, and Georgia was born June 21, 2023.
The gold medalist swimmer and former Playboy Playmate tied the knot in Palm Springs, California, in January 2018, after previously going public with their relationship in 2016.
